Lysozyme, also called cell wall hydrolase, specially function to peptidoglycan, chainmaterial of cell wall, exists in many tissues and secretion for animal, plant, protozoa, insect aswell as microorganism. Lysozyme is a kind of protein, has been widely used in food,medicine and biology for its safety. The commercial lysozyme, mainly obtained from hen eggwhite, only function to gram positive bacteria, so its applied field was limited. In recent yearsthe research to lysozyme from many source have been done widely, but the report of researchto lysozyme from marine life was very little. In this the research to purification andphysico-chemical properties of a new marine life lysozyme had been done, made a foundationto further research and application to marine life lysozyme.A lysozyme from the intestine of sea cucumbers was purified through the Cloud PointExtraction (CPE), cation-exchange chromatography with CM52cellulose and gel filtrationchromatography with Sephadex G-75.The result show that, cation-exchange chromatography with CM52cellulose had aevident effect to purification of lysozyme, and purification fold was11.3. The purificationfold of lysozyme through gel filtration chromatography with Sephadex G-75after CM52was18.7. Finally, the specific activity, purification fold and yield of lysozyme were3026.1U/mg,18.7and46%, respectively.The final enzyme preparation was nearly homogeneous in SDS-PAGE and its molecularweight was estimated as approximately16kD. The optimum pH and temperature againstMicrococcus lysodleikticus were pH6.5and35℃, respectively, and the enzyme was stable attemperature below45℃and pH4.0~8.0. The purified lysozyme has showed broad-spectrumagainst many bacteria, not only inhibiting the growth of Gram-positive bacteria, but also andGram-negative bacteria as well as a number of pathogens.
